DentaQuest manages dental and vision benefits for more than 33 million Americans. Our outcomes-based, cost-effective solutions are designed for Medicaid and CHIP, Medicare Advantage, small and large businesses, and individuals. With a focus on prevention and value, we aim to make quality care accessible to improve the oral health of all.

The opportunity:

The Client Partner is responsible for contract deliverables, including compliance reporting, financial reporting and service level performance reporting. The Client Partner is also responsible for ensuring effective coordination and communication of client requests to ensure client expectations are satisfied.

How you will contribute:

Responsible for on-going, effective communications and service to the current clients via on-site meetings, conference calls, and day-to-day interaction.

Provide support to DentaQuest leadership for administration of the client\xe2\x80\x99s program, and communicate information accurately and efficiently, to ensure that DQ is meeting and exceeding client expectations, and the terms of the RFP and contract.

Identify and communicate client expectations to DQ leadership and staff, and ensure expectations are delivered effectively. Resolve issues and strengthen relationships at various professional levels within the client\xe2\x80\x99s organization.

Responsible for coordination and serving as primary point of contact for client audits of DentaQuest programs to include coordination of documentation requests, meeting organization, and responding to auditor follow-up requests to DentaQuest.

Develop and maintain relationships with appropriate functional areas within DentaQuest to ensure effective contract performance.

Support innovative business practices and process improvement opportunities for current and prospective clients (e.g., P4Q, QARR, ER Diversion).

Monitor changes in regulations and fee schedules, and communicate same to ensure compliance with state and federal guidelines.

Perform functions that support timely and accurate reporting to clients.

Responsible for updating Office Reference Manuals, implementing corrective action plan response and effectively organizing client audits.

Develops and submits IODs based on CMS, market- or client-specific program requirements.

Manages process for obtaining program requirements, documentation, support and other special requests from clients.

Provides regular updates to senior management on internal and external issues affecting market performance.

Represent DentaQuest at health fairs, conferences and advisory meetings through the State.

Other duties as assigned.

If you are a California resident, the salary range for this position is:

Southern region: $64,400-$96,600 annually.

Central region: $77,900-$101,800 annually.

Northern region: $72,500-$108,900 annually.

If you are a Colorado resident, the salary range for this position is 61,400-$92,200 annually.

If you are a New York resident, the salary range for this position is $72,500-$108,900 annually.

If you are Washington resident, the salary range for this position is $77,900-$101,800 annually.

We consider various factors in determining actual pay including your skills, qualifications, and experience. In addition to salary, this position is eligible for incentive awards based on individual and business performance as well as a broad range of competitive benefits.
